Gary Sharp b64ac3b16f Feature #44: Image capture WebRTC & HTML5 FileIO
Silverlight was previously used to capture webcam pictures and upload
file attachments. HTML5 FileIO is now used for all attachment uploading
- including drag-drop support. WebRTC is used to capture webcam images -
this falls back to a Flash polyfill when WebRTC isn't supported.
